    Folders on desktop not showing what's inside


    This one has me vexed. I want the folders on the desktop to show the contents. At one time they did show the contents but now they don't. In fact yesterday I got the folders to show the contents. I think I did it by restoring defaults under "folder options" in Control Panel. But today they are again just the folder.

    I think I know why the folders changed, due to CCleaner cleaning out the thumbnail cache. So how do I get the contents to show again?

    Screenshots show how the folders look on desktop and the same two folders in Explorer with the contents showing. But now of course after messing around even the Explorer folders aren't showing contents.

    Does it have to do with Aero or desktop theme? Confused.

    OK I think I did it. Within Explorer I went to the desktop. I right clicked on each individual folder--properties-->customize-->change icon-->restore defaults. A couple of them I had to change the folder icon to something else then restore the defaults but eventually I got it.

    Here is my desktop right now. Will it stay that way is the question?

    Now how about CCleaner? If I have "thumbnail caches" checked under Windows Explorer it currently finds 6 files, 14,000KB. I bet if I clean those my desktop and maybe Explorer folder previews (for desktop) will disappear. Thoughts?

    No, that would only clear the thumbnail cache so that the thumbnails will reload the next time you view them. It will not turn off thumbnail previews.
